Gideon, a humble man called to lead Israel, finds himself in a daunting situation. He is overwhelmed by the task ahead and fearful of the consequences. In this moment, God speaks directly to him, offering words of peace and assurance. This encounter highlights a profound truth: God's presence dispels fear. When God says, "Peace! Do not be afraid," it is a reminder that His peace transcends human understanding and circumstances. Gideon's fear of death is met with divine assurance of life and safety, illustrating that God's plans are for our good, not harm.
This message is timeless, encouraging believers to trust in God's promises and presence. It teaches that fear is a natural response, but it does not have to be the final word. God's peace is available to all who seek it, providing strength and courage to face life's challenges. In moments of doubt and fear, turning to God and trusting in His promises can transform our perspective, allowing us to move forward with confidence and hope.
